信息学奥赛NOIP初赛复习知识点 .pdf
《信息学奥赛NOIP初赛复习知识点 .pdf》由会员分享,可在线阅读,更多相关《信息学奥赛NOIP初赛复习知识点 .pdf(6页珍藏版)》请在淘文阁 - 分享文档赚钱的网站上搜索。
1、学习好资料欢迎下载信息学奥赛 NOIP 初赛复习知识点1、计算机相关科学家:A A: 被西方人誉为“计算机之父”的美籍匈牙利科学家、 数学家 冯 诺依曼 于 1945 年发表了一个全新的 存储程序通用电子计算机方案 EDVAC 。EDVAC 方案提出了著名的“ 冯诺依曼体系结构”理论: (1)采用二进制形式表示数据和指令(2)采用存储程序方式(3)由运算器、存储器、控制器、输入设备和输出设备五大部件组成计算机系统B B:“图灵机”与“冯诺伊曼机”齐名,被永远载入计算机的发展史中。 1950 年 10 月,图灵又发表了另一篇题为“机器能思考吗”的论文, 成为划时代之作。 也正是这篇文章, 为图灵
2、赢得了“人工智能之父人工智能之父”的桂冠。与计算机有关的最高奖项“图灵奖” 。2、与竞赛有关的知识:A A:信息学奥赛相关的软件有:信息学奥赛相关的软件有:anjuta 1.2.2 版; Red Hat 9.0 自带了 gcc/g+ 3.2.2gcc/g+ 3.2.2 版; Lazarus 0.9.10 版; free pascalfree pascal 编译器编译器 2.0.12.0.1 版;版; gdb 6.3 版;RHIDERHIDE;(turbo pascal 淘汰)3、与计算机系统相关的知识:A A: 常见的操作系统有: DOS、 WIN32、 WIN95、 WIN98、 WIN20
3、00、 WINXP、 WIN2003、 WIN2007、LINUX、VISTA4、与计算机软件相关的知识:无5、与计算机硬件相关的知识:A A:断电后能保存信息的有:ROM(只读存储器) 、硬盘、软盘、光盘、 U 盘、MP3、MP4 等;不能保存的主要是 RAM(读写存储器) 。B B:CPU 又名中央处理器,它可以拆分成运算器、控制器6、病毒及防火墙:A A:防火墙的作用是防止黑客攻击。7、与编程语言相关的知识:A A:1972 年 PARC 发布了 Smalltalk 的第一个版本。大约在此时,“面向对象”这一术语正式确定。Smalltalk 被认为是第一个真正面向对象的语言B B:第一代
4、语言:机器语言(0101001) ;第二代语言:20 世纪 50 年代,汇编语言,第三代语言:高级语言、算法语言,如 BASIC,FORTRAN,COBOL,PASCAL,C;高级语言的特点是可读性强,编程方便;第四代语言:非过程化语言;SQL;第五代语言:智能性语言,PROLOG(代表) ;还有:LISP,APL,SNOBOL,SIMULA。学习好资料欢迎下载C C: 编程时读入一个很大的二维数组, 按行读和按列读相比, 输入效率上 (取决于数组的存储方式) 。8、计算机算法知识:A A:算法特点:算法特点:算法的改进,在很大程度上推动了计算机科学与技术的进步;判断一个算法的好坏的主要标准是
5、算法的时间复杂性与空间复杂性;目前仍然存在许多涉及到国计民生的重大课题,还没有找到能够在计算机上实施的有效算法;B B:采用比较为主要操作的算法是:冒泡、插入、选择排序9、函数或表达式:A A:PASCAL语言中,表达式(21 XOR 2)的值是(23)B B:PASCAL语言,判断 a 不等于 0 且 b 不等于 0 的正确的条件表达式是(a0)and(b0)10、数据结构基础:A A:栈的出入顺序是先进后出,队列是先进先出;例如:某个车站呈狭长形,宽度只能容下一台车,并且出入口是一个。已知某时刻该车站状态为空,从这一时刻开始的出入记录为: “进、出、进、进、进、出、出、进、进、出、出” 。
6、假设车辆入站的顺序为1,2,3,4,5,6,7 则车辆出站的顺序为(1,4,3,7,6) 。B B: 高度为 N 的均衡的二叉树是: 如果去掉叶结点及相应的树枝, 它应该是高度为 N-1 的满二叉树。在这里,树高等于叶结点的最大深度,根结点的深度为 0,如果某个均衡的二叉树共有 2381 个结点,则该树的树高为(11) 。C C: (1 1)结点的度:)结点的度:一个结点的子树数目称为该结点的度(区分图中结点的度) 。图中,结点i 度为3,结点 t 的度为 2,结点 b 的度为 1。显然,所有树叶的度为0。 (2 2)树的度:)树的度:所有结点中最大的度称为该树的度(宽度) 。 (3)树的深度
7、(高度)树的深度(高度) :树是分层次的。结点所在的层次是从根算起的。根结点在第一层,根的儿子在第二层,其余各层依次类推。图中的树共有五层。在树中,父结点在同一层的所有结点构成兄弟关系。树中最大的层次称为树的深度,亦称高度。D D:树的表示除自然界的树形表示法外(画图)还有括号表示法括号表示法:先将根结点放入一对圆括号中,然后把它的子树按由左而右的顺序放入括号中,而对子树也采用同样方法处理:同层子树与它的根结点用圆括号括起来,同层子树之间用逗号隔开,最后用闭括号括起来。例如图可写成如下形式( r(a(w,x(d(h) ,e) ) ,b(f) ,c(s,t(i(m,o,n) ,j) ,u) )
8、)E E:二叉树的递归定义和基本形态:二叉树是以结点为元素的有限集,它或者为空,或者满足以下条件:有一个特定的结点称为根;余下的结点分为互不相交的子集L 和 R,其中 L 是根的左子树;R是根的右子树;L 和 R 又是二叉树;F F:二叉树的两个特殊形态:满二叉树: 若深度为 K 的二叉树,共有 2K-1 个结点,即第 I 层有 2I-1 的结点,称为满二叉树。完全二叉树:如果一棵二叉树最多只有最下面两层结点度数可以小于2,并且最下面一层的结点都集中在该层最左边的若干位置上,则称此二叉树为完全二叉树G G:二叉树的三个主要性质:性质 1:在二叉树的第 i(1)层上,最多有 2i-1 个结点性质
- 配套讲稿:
如PPT文件的首页显示word图标,表示该PPT已包含配套word讲稿。双击word图标可打开word文档。
- 特殊限制:
部分文档作品中含有的国旗、国徽等图片,仅作为作品整体效果示例展示,禁止商用。设计者仅对作品中独创性部分享有著作权。
- 关 键 词:
- 信息学奥赛NOIP初赛复习知识点 信息学 NOIP 初赛 复习 知识点
限制150内